Can't install due to OFD issue

Trying to install hie, I'm running into the following build error:

Failed to build lukko-0.1.1.2.

Configuring library for lukko-0.1.1.2..
Preprocessing library for lukko-0.1.1.2..
In file included from dist/build/Lukko/OFD_hsc_make.c:1:0:
OFD.hsc: In function ‘main’:
OFD.hsc:167:16: error: ‘F_OFD_SETLKW’ undeclared (first use in this function)

OFD.hsc:168:16: error: ‘F_OFD_SETLK’ undeclared (first use in this function)

compiling dist/build/Lukko/OFD_hsc_make.c failed (exit code 1)
command was: /usr/lib64/ccache/gcc -c dist/build/Lukko/OFD_hsc_make.c -o dist/build/Lukko/OFD_hsc_make.o -std=gnu99 -std=gnu99 -D__GLASGOW_HASKELL__=808 -Dlinux_BUILD_OS=1 -Dx86_64_BUILD_ARCH=1 -Dlinux_HOST_OS=1 -Dx86_64_HOST_ARCH=1 -DUSE_OFD_LOCKING -Idist/build/autogen -Idist/build/global-autogen -include dist/build/autogen/cabal_macros.h -I/home/jkaye/.ghcup/ghc/8.8.3/lib/ghc-8.8.3/base-4.13.0.0/include -I/home/jkaye/.ghcup/ghc/8.8.3/lib/ghc-8.8.3/integer-gmp-1.0.2.0/include -I/home/jkaye/.ghcup/ghc/8.8.3/lib/ghc-8.8.3/include -I/home/jkaye/.ghcup/ghc/8.8.3/lib/ghc-8.8.3/include/
cabal: Failed to build lukko-0.1.1.2 (which is required by exe:script from
fake-package-0). See the build log above for details.

I've tried building with both clang and gcc, both give the same error. Ghc and cabal both compile and run without issues, but I'm unable to install stack or hie due to this, and I can't seem to find much information about what is going on here or what I can do to fix it. Does anyone have any insight?
